Arabella's Quiet Gaze
Arabella, Abandoned Doll arrives from Duskmourn House of Horror as a Light Play Foil uncommon that slots neatly into sacrifice themes and creepier black builds. Arabella reads like a compact engine for attrition: she taxes opponents on entry and grows when the board collapses around her. The card plays low to the curve and rewards trades; bring her in early and she pressures life totals while funding a slow grind that rewards careful timing.
In lore she is the echo of a child's toy left in a corridor where the lights do not reach. In practice she is a practical inclusion for commander decks that like incremental advantage and for draft pools where a repeatable value creature matters. The foil treatment catches the set artwork without obscuring key text so players who want both playability and shelf presence get a tidy package.
Card Details:
-
Mana Cost – {1}{B}
-
Card Type – Creature
-
Subtypes – Construct Horror
-
Card Text / Rules Text (Printed) – When Arabella, Abandoned Doll enters the battlefield, each opponent loses 1 life and you gain 1 life. Whenever another creature dies, put a +1/+1 counter on Arabella, Abandoned Doll.
-
Power / Toughness – 1/2
